Select [Create Authorization Groups].
2
Select [Group Name], and then select [Create/Delete].
3
Select and set any item.
îš„ Group Name
Enter a group name with up to 32 single-byte characters.
îš„ Restrict Recipient Selection Method
When [Only From Address Book] is selected for [Restrict Recipient Selection Method] under
[Tools] > [Common Service Settings] > [Other Settings], a transmission to a recipient who is
not registered on the Address Book is restricted for the Fax / Internet Fax or E-mail Service.
Set whether or not to cancel the restriction.
îš„ Restrict User to Edit Address Book
When [Yes] is selected for [Restrict User to Edit Address Book] under [Tools] > [Common
Service Settings] > [Other Settings], local users cannot register / edit the Address Book. Set
whether or not to cancel the restriction.
z
When [Only From Address Book] is selected for [Restrict Recipient Selection Method] under [Tools] >
[Common Service Settings] > [Other Settings], shift the select [No Restriction] to enable the local users to
register / edit the Address Book.
îš„ Allow User to Disable Active Settings
Select whether or not to permit the group members to temporarily disable the forcible
printing features, such as the Force Watermark, Print Universal Unique ID, and Force
Annotation features, and to allow the machine to process a job.

User Details Setup
Set the information required when carrying out authentication.
îš„ Alternative Name for User ID
If required, you can change the indication "UserID" on the [Login] screen that appears
when the <Log In/Out> button on the control panel is pressed to another name such as
"User Name" or "Number". The alias can be set to 1 to 15 single-byte characters.
z
The name changed is also printed in a report or a list.
